# File lib/docker/util.rb, line 58
  def hijack_for(stdin, block, msg_stack, tty)
    attach_block = attach_for(block, msg_stack, tty)

    lambda do |socket|
      debug "hijack: hijacking the HTTP socket"
      threads = []

      debug "hijack: starting stdin copy thread"
      threads << Thread.start do
        debug "hijack: copying stdin => socket"
        IO.copy_stream stdin, socket

        debug "hijack: closing write end of hijacked socket"
        close_write(socket)
      end

      debug "hijack: starting hijacked socket read thread"
      threads << Thread.start do
        debug "hijack: reading from hijacked socket"

        begin
          while chunk = socket.readpartial(512)
            debug "hijack: got #{chunk.bytesize} bytes from hijacked socket"
            attach_block.call chunk, nil, nil
          end
        rescue EOFError
        end

        debug "hijack: killing stdin copy thread"
        threads.first.kill
      end

      threads.each(&:join)
    end
  end
